Modifications to the HIPAA Privacy, Security, Enforcement, and Breach Notification Rules Under the HITECH Act & the Genetic InformationNondiscrimination Act; Other Modifications to the HIPAA Rules
January 25, 2013
The U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) released the final "Omnibus Rule" for the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A), which seeks to strengthen privacy and security protections. Key provisions include higher fines for breaching patient privacy and expansion of responsibility to third-party business associates handling patient data. The new rule is effective March 26, 2013.
